A quick question from a newbie. I just discovered that a wren had built a nest at the bottom of a large plastic tub we have in the carport - the lid was slightly ajar and there is a baby wren in the bottom hopping around calling. I did not disturb the tub at all, but I was wondering will the baby be able to escape when it is time for it to fly? The plastic tub sides are about knee high and smooth. Thanks!
